Nominal: 640 Hz Weight: 1781 lbs Diameter: 45.4" Bell 1 of 7
Founded by John Taylor & Co 1920
Dove Bell ID: 2649 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Nominal: 1078.4 Hz Weight: 646 lbs Diameter: 30.9" Bell 2 of 7
Founded by John Warner & Sons 1866
Dove Bell ID: 21356 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Nominal: 961 Hz Weight: 560 lbs Diameter: 30.7" Bell 3 of 7
Founded by Lewis Cockey 1694
Dove Bell ID: 21357 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Nominal: 854.8 Hz Weight: 687 lbs Diameter: 32.5" Bell 4 of 7
Founded by Lewis Cockey 1694
Dove Bell ID: 21358 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Nominal: 808.6 Hz Weight: 837 lbs Diameter: 35.4" Bell 5 of 7
Founded by John Warner & Sons 1866
Dove Bell ID: 21359 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Nominal: 720.4 Hz Weight: 938 lbs Diameter: 37.9" Bell 6 of 7
Founded by William Knight 1733
Dove Bell ID: 21360 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Turnings: eighth Cracked: No
Weight: 66 lbs Diameter: 13.88" Bell 7 of 7
Founded by Lewis Cockey
Dove Bell ID: 21361 Tower ID: 14274 - View Tower Listed: No Canons: Removed Cracked: No
